Noosa News Don’t extend police powers, QLS warns – Proctor Published 10 months ago on May 1, 2025 By Noosa Online News Publisher Share Tweet ADVERTISEMENT Queensland Law Society cautioned against the expansion of police powers under Jack’s Law, at a public hearing at Parliament House yesterday. QLS Children’s Law Committee Chair Damian Bartholomew and QLS Criminal Law Committee Chair Kristy Bell addressed the State… Click here to view the original article.
